Output 71f86101b88828d68db754e853c182af2a5c3a3c2cf5d70c788ce0e1b044493a:1

value
163807992820
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 888427c6c5ac8181910d95c4b6b3a2fe5b632365 OP_EQUALVERIFY OP_CHECKSIG
address
DHavkfTifYZrJPtZ2Lq5UmN3LioywPxvPD
transaction
71f86101b88828d68db754e853c182af2a5c3a3c2cf5d70c788ce0e1b044493a